What defines a leading factory in the modern age of energy storage?
Modern suppliers are prioritizing Lithium Iron Phosphate (LFP) for its superior safety profile and longer lifespan, reaching up to 8,000-10,000 cycles in high-end models.
Intelligent Battery Management Systems (BMS) now use AI to predict usage patterns, optimize charging cycles, and prevent thermal runaway before it happens.
Vehicle-to-Home (V2H) technology is the next frontier, allowing residential storage systems to interact seamlessly with Electric Vehicle batteries for a unified home grid.
Top factories are designing "Lego-like" systems. Start with 5kWh and expand to 50kWh without replacing the original unit, catering to growing family needs.
Global procurement needs emphasize remote diagnostics. Real-time Bluetooth and Wi-Fi monitoring are now standard requirements for industrial and residential systems.
While LFP dominates, R&D in semi-solid and solid-state batteries is the trend suppliers are watching to further increase energy density and safety.
